3. Staying at an Eco-Conscious Riverside Homestay

True connection extends to where you lay your head at night. Instead of an isolated, Westernized hotel block that looks like it could be anywhere in the world, slow travel invites you into eco-conscious, locally run riverside homestays and boutique lodges.

These spaces are built with sustainability at their core, using local materials and minimizing plastic waste to protect the delicate delta ecosystem. Staying here means your money goes directly into the hands of the community, all while you enjoy an incredibly romantic setting:

  • The soothing, natural sounds of the delta lulling you to sleep at night.

  • Stepping out of your room right onto the riverbank for an early morning stroll together.

4. The Intimacy of a Traditional Circular-Table Dinner

Perhaps the best part of a culturally intimate couples trip to Vietnam is the connection made over food. In the evening, you won't be sitting at an isolated table for two in a sterile, brightly lit hotel dining room. Instead, you are invited to join a local family around a traditional circular table.

"Food is our love language in Vietnam. Sharing a home-cooked meal as equals with a local family bridges cultures without needing a single word of translation."

Together with your partner, you’ll learn the art of rolling the perfect fresh spring roll, share laughter over stories gently translated by your guide, and savor the vibrant flavors of sizzling bánh xèo, crafted from ingredients freshly picked in the backyard garden. It’s a warm, grounding moment—one that quietly reminds you what meaningful travel is all about.
